Class KinematicChainWidget

Inheritance Relationships

Base Type

  • public QWidget

Class Documentation

class KinematicChainWidget : public QWidget

Public Functions

KinematicChainWidget(QWidget *parent, RVizPanel *rviz_panel)

Constructor.

void setAvailable(const LinkNameTree &link_name_tree)

Loads the available data list.

void setSelected(const std::string &base_link, const std::string &tip_link)

Set the link field with previous value.

QTreeWidgetItem *addLinkChildRecursive(QTreeWidgetItem *parent, const LinkNameTree &link)

Public Members

QLabel *title_

Signals

void doneEditing()

Event sent when this widget is done making data changes and parent widget can save.

void cancelEditing()

Event sent when user presses cancel button.